actually, the rig very much matters.The amp just makes a bigger copy of what went into it, especially if it is clean and full range. The amp has no effect on what kind of pot you use.
linears really shine for V/V setups, because they make finding the "sweet spot" easier.You don't necessarily want an audio taper for any application except a volume control. For example in a V/V/T setup the V pots are both volume and blend controls so should they be linear or log? Reasonable people may disagree on that. I don't know that there is any advantage to a log pot on a tone control.

audio tapers on basses (especially 500ks) will have an annoyingly big drop-off from "10", with little left by the time you get to "2" or "3".
linear taper volume pots will evenly sweep from full-up to off.

I just looked up what (precious little) quantitative information I could find on actual audio taper volume controls. They do in fact seem to be two segment linear approximations and that makes them no better than linear pots.
A linear pot increases too fast at low volumes compared to the ideal, an audio pot too slow and both do the opposite at high volumes of course.

yes it does, and the difference also makes linear volumes a better choice.Keep in mind that this is all predicated on using a volume pot as it was intended, with the output taken from the wiper. A single pickup bass will be wired that way, a B/V/T bass may be, a V/V/T bass (Fender's at least) has the input on the wiper with the output on the top of the pot and I do not know if that makes a difference.
half-right; like i mentioned earlier; that's why audio taper volumes are good for guitar players, who use a way more compressed and distorted signal than typical bass players.A compressor will tend to exaggerate the error of a linear pot but bring the audio pot closer to the ideal. With a clean amp one is about as bad as the other.

Both kinds miss the ideal curve by the same amount with a linear amp. I'm not sure why the typical audio pot is so far off. I suspect that current thinking on the ideal curve is different from what it was thought to be back when the audio taper was picked and people just keep making pots to the old curve because that is what they have always done. The linear slider pots for high end audio applications are available in bilinear audio tapers that fit the ideal curve quite well.

fender originally put 250k audios in all positions of all their guitars and basses up until the jazzmaster, and my guess is that folks are just used to it, so they keep doing it.
It could also be that audios did work better in the compressed, relatively low-wattage tube "bass" amps of the '50s, when the fender bass was first introduced.
